Hello everyone, just wanted to provide an update on my experience.  It turns out that my account was hacked after all.  There are warranty scammers out there who will get access to people’s Fitbit accounts and then try to submit a fake warranty claim so they can get a brand new Fitbit.  I am not sure how they were able to hack me, but I suspect through Facebook, so I have changed my Facebook login credentials.  

 

Meanwhile, over at Fitbit, my case was escalated to a tier two support group, and they were able to change my email back to my real email, allowing me to log in and access my account that I’ve had for years.  They were really great and helpful - I’m very happy to be back in business with all my step history.  If you’re having this issue, there is hope!  You just have to make your way to this senior support group.  Good luck!
